			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Photography is a process of taking and printing photographs. In general photograph is a recorder of our memories. These photographs are printed to keep for permanent preservation. The images in the photos are immovable and silent. But they represent the nature and mood of the situation and thus understanding the meaning.<br />
During photography, the light passes through the lens into the cassette in the cassette back of the media image. Based on the actual light intensity and the difference in ability photosensitive medium, required illumination times are also different. In the light process, the media were sensitive. Photography to complete, the medium of video information must be retained through the conversion and re-read. Specific method depends on the characteristics of light-sensitive means and the media.<br />
Photography and painting are the same. Each renders imagination in tangible form. The best thing is that photography is much easier for a layman to use and create what looks like a technically passable, sharp and well-exposed image. As most beginners discover instantly, simply having the best tools and technically sharp images doesn&#8217;t get the glorious, passion-inspiring results they intended.</p>
